Dr. Ruth A Pryor, MD
22 Atwood Dr, Northampton, MA 01060
Obstetrician-gynecologist
More Business Info
- Hours
- Regular Hours
Mon - Fri: - AKA
Pryor, Ruth, MD
- Other Link
https://www.cooleydickinson.org/doctors-providers/ruth-pryor-md
- Categories
- Physicians & Surgeons, Physicians & Surgeons, Gynecology, Physicians & Surgeons, Obstetrics And Gynecology
Suggest an Edit